2026 Masters Tournament: Dates, TV Channels, and More
All the key details on when and how to watch golf's most prestigious major championship.

The 2026 Masters will feature a new generation of golf stars vying for the prestigious green jacket.Augusta TodayThe 90th annual Masters Tournament is set to take place from April 9-12, 2026 at Augusta National Golf Club in Augusta, Georgia. While some notable names like Tiger Woods and Phil Mickelson will be absent, the world's top golfers including Scottie Scheffler and Rory McIlroy will be competing for the coveted green jacket. The tournament will be broadcast across multiple platforms, with Amazon Prime Video, ESPN, and CBS all providing coverage.
Why it matters
The Masters is one of the most prestigious events in all of sports, drawing massive viewership and attention each year. With the absence of some iconic players, it will be an opportunity for new stars to emerge and cement their legacies in the game of golf.
The details
The 2026 Masters will begin on Thursday, April 9 and conclude on Sunday, April 12. For the first time ever, Amazon Prime Video will carry live streaming coverage of the first two rounds on Thursday and Friday, while ESPN will provide linear cable coverage during those days. On the weekend, CBS will take over the main broadcast feed, with the first two hours of Saturday and Sunday's rounds airing exclusively on Paramount+ before the network takes over.
- The 90th Masters Tournament will take place from April 9-12, 2026.
- The first two rounds on Thursday and Friday will be streamed live on Amazon Prime Video and aired on ESPN.
- The final two rounds on Saturday and Sunday will be broadcast on CBS, with the first two hours airing exclusively on Paramount+.
The players
Scottie Scheffler
The current world No. 1 golfer and one of the favorites to win the 2026 Masters.
Rory McIlroy
The defending Masters champion, looking to win his second green jacket.
Tiger Woods
The five-time Masters winner will miss the 2026 tournament for the second consecutive year.
Phil Mickelson
Another iconic golfer who will not be competing in the 2026 Masters due to personal family health issues.
